Voting For the 5th phase of Lok Sabha Elections has been completed. Maharashtra was in the spotlight as 13 constituencies, including the significant six seats in Mumbai, voted on Monday in the fifth phase of Lok Sabha elections 2024. Several Big Politicians and actors from Mumbai came forward to cast their votes. This marked the final polling process in the state, which has been conducted over five phases: April 19, April 26, May 7, May 13, and May 20. And the counting is scheduled for June 4. People in large number gathered to vote for their favorite candidates. However, the financial capital witnessed a low voter turnout. Mumbai saw voter turnout of 48.66% by the end of the day. Until 3pm Mumbai was struggling to even cross 40% voter turnout with state turnout at 38.77%
